The differences between the laser welding machine single wire feeder and the double wire feeder

I. Single Wire Feeding Machine

A single wire feeding machine refers to a type of fiber optic handheld welding rod wire feeding device that has only one wire feeder. The wire feeding rate can be adjusted according to the requirements. The advantages of a single wire feeding machine are simple structure, convenient operation, and relatively affordable price; the disadvantages are that during the welding process, the weld seam is prone to significant fluctuations, and the welding work requires higher technical proficiency.

II. Dual Wire Feeders
A dual wire feeder refers to a situation in an optical fiber handheld welding rod feeder where there are two wire feeders, which can separately control the main welding wire and the compensating wire. The feeding rates of the main welding wire and the compensating wire can be independently adjusted as needed. During the welding process, it is possible to more precisely control the welding quality, reduce welding deformation, and increase welding speed and production efficiency.

III. Differences and Comparisons

The main difference between single-feed wire machines and double-feed wire machines lies in the feed wire method. The single-feed wire machine has only one feed wire device, and the feed speed of the welding wire can only be controlled by a single device, resulting in lower welding quality and efficiency. In contrast, the double-feed wire machine has two feed wire devices, which can independently adjust the feed speeds of the main welding wire and the compensating wire. This makes the welding more precise and the welding quality higher. However, the disadvantage of the double-feed wire machine is that it is more expensive compared to the single-feed wire machine.

IV. Conclusion
In conclusion, the single wire feeder machine and the double wire feeder machine each have their own advantages and disadvantages. The choice of which machine to use depends on the specific requirements of the welding task. If the welding requirements are not high and only simple welding tasks need to be completed, a single wire feeder machine can be chosen. If the welding requirements are high and precise weld quality needs to be achieved, then a double wire feeder machine should be selected. At the same time, the double wire feeder machine is more expensive, and economic practicality needs to be considered.
